Kayıt Ol

Giriş


Şifremi Kaybettim

Şifreni mi unuttun? Lütfen e-mail adresinizi giriniz. Bir bağlantı alacaksınız ve e-posta yoluyla yeni bir şifre oluşturacaksınız.

Giriş


Kayıt Ol

Merhaba, kayıt formu üzerinden kayıt olabilirsiniz. Fakat sosyal medya ile kayıt olmanızı önermekteyiz.

Python Çok Parametreli Fonksiyonlar

Python Çok Parametreli Fonksiyonlar

Python Çok Parametreli Fonksiyonlar

Python fonksiyonlarında istediğiniz kadar istediğiniz tipte argüman gönderebilirsiniz.  Daha öncek örnekte parametresiz ve tek parametreli fonksiyonları anlattık. Şimdi iki veya ikiden fazla parametreli fonksiyonları inceleyeceğiz.

Fonksiyon yapımızı hatırlıyalım : def fonksiyonadı (Parametreler) :

Fonksiyon yapısını öğrendiğimize göre, basit bir fonksiyon oluşturalım.

Temel kullanımından bahsetmek adına yukarıda , iki parametreli(x,y) fonksiyon yapısı oluşturduk.

Fonksiyon yapımızı artık canlandıralım şöyle bir örnek yapalım : iki parametreli fonksiyonumuz olsun, bu parametreye 2 adet sayısal veri yollasın. Yollanan değerler toplanip bize sonucu iletsin.

Yukarıdaki yapıyı incelediğimiz zaman şöyle bir çıktı alacağız;

def ile oluşturduğumuz Fonksiyon yapısında iki adet parametre aliyor bunlar x ve y’dir. Fonksiyon(5,3) şeklinde çağırıldığı zaman şöyle bir sonuç olucaktır : x=5 , y=3 olarak depolanacaktır. Bu değeler hemen fonksiyon parametresine girdi olarak işleyecektir. Girdiler “topla” denilen değişkende toplanıcak yani şöyle : topla=x+y , topla=5+3=8 sonucu elde edeceğiz. Burada return kulladık çünkü oluşan sonucu çağırılan yere göndermek içindir.

Mantığı bu şekilde kurabiliriz, istediğiniz projeye göre fonksiyonlar oluşacaktir.

Sonuç olarak ;

  • Parametre nedir öğrendik.
  • Fonksiyon nedir öğrendik.
  • Çok parametreli fonksiyon nedir öğrendik.
  • Çok parametreli fonksiyon nasıl oluşturulur ve mantığı nedir öğrendik.

Hakkında Ali YamanYenilmez

Mühendis adayı, yazılım geliştirici ve haftanın hergünü yazılım ile zamanını geçiren ve kendini geliştiren pratik ve işine sahip öz verili biriyimdir. Web yazılım ve geliştirme alanında kendimi geliştirmekteyim ve hergün yeni birşey öğrenmeden günümü bitirmiyorum.

Beni Takip Et

Yorumlar ( 3 )

  1. return topla komutunu çıkardığımız zaman output olarak None çıkıyor nedenini anlıyamadım

    Saygılarımla

    • “return” fonksiyon içerisinde gerçekleşen sonucu geri gönderiyor. Eğer return olmazssa birşey dönmeyeceği için “none” yazar.

  2. Hocam bu fonksiyonu bir doyaya nasıl yazdırız ugraştım boş cıkıyor Fonksiyon(x,y)
    dosya yaz diye ama içi boş cıkıyor konsolda görüyorum sonucu

Cevap yazın

Captcha Captcha güncellemek için resime tıkla